摘 要:大型水电机组普遍采用SiC非线性灭磁电阻进行灭磁,实时监测SiC非线性灭磁电阻事故灭磁过程中及灭磁后的特性,对于大型机组的安全运行至关重要。ESA-1装置研制目标是对SiC非线性灭磁电阻进行在线监测。本文论述了该系统在白山300MW水电机组上的应用情况,并对现场实测结果进行了初步分析,分析结果表明该系统可满足大型水电机组灭磁装置的在线监测需求。此外,该系统也适用于汽轮发电机等其它类型机组灭磁装置的在线监测。The SiC nonlinear de-excitation resistors are generally applied :in de-excitation devices for large-sized hydropower generating units. It is very important for safely operating large-sized hydropower generating units where the parameters are monitored real-timely during and after accidental de-excitation. The target of developing ESA-1 device is on-line monitoring SiC nonlinear de-excitation resistors. The authors applied the system at a 300MW hydropower generating unit in the Baishan hydropower station, and analyzed the results of field measurement. It shows that the system can meet the requirements of de-excitation device online monitoring for large-sized hydropower generating units. In addition, the system is also suitable for other types of generator units, such as steam turbo-generator units.
